How they compare
Lithuania currently reports 77,332 1000 USD against 58,154 1000 USD in New Caledonia, a difference of 19,178 1000 USD.
That makes Lithuania's figure about 1.3 times New Caledonia's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 10 shared years of data; in 2015 it was Lithuania ahead.
Lithuania ranks 105th and New Caledonia ranks 108th of 148 countries.
Lithuania has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Lithuania | New Caledonia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 60,511 1000 USD | 35,474 1000 USD | 25,037 1000 USD | Lithuania |
| 2020s | 63,414 1000 USD | 52,597 1000 USD | 10,817 1000 USD | Lithuania |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
